Fans Encouraged to Arrive Early for Comets Whiteout

April 27, 2015 - American Hockey League (AHL)
Utica Comets News Release


Fans attending Game 3 of the Comets' Western Conference Quarterfinals with the Chicago Wolves are encouraged to arrive well before the 7p.m. puck drop to take part in the pregame festivities. Fans are also urged to be seated by 6:45p.m. in order to create the ideal atmosphere. Doors will open to everyone at 5:35p.m.

Inside the arena, all fans will be given a WHITE #BuiltForThis rally pom-pom upon entrance to the Utica Memorial Auditorium. Face painters will be available, free of charge, starting at 5:30p.m.

For every home playoff game, all fans that enter the building dressed in WHITE will receive a raffle ticket for a chance to win an authentic, game-worn WHITE inaugural season jersey. Winners of the WHITE game-worn jerseys will be announced throughout the game. There will be multiple jerseys given away each game.

Leading up to the game, the Comets will be hosting a social media campaign, encouraging fans to change their Facebook and Twitter profile photos to the one matching the Comets.

It is also suggested fans arrive as early as possible to alleviate possible traffic issues entering the arena.
